The 1st Gen weren’t that great either in many aspects. If before mid 1990 they had the 15.9mm oil pickup tube and respectable pump. That generation were very prone to bearing issues, plus the intake leaks which caused oil and coolant mix. We put a lot of engines in those at the dealerships I’ve worked at.
